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Modelos de Datos y Modelado Conceptual

37,098 views

Published on

Published in: Technology
  • Be the first to comment

Modelos de Datos y Modelado Conceptual

  1. 3. Modelos <ul><li>Es una representación de objetos y sucesos del “MUNDO REAL” , así como de sus asociaciones. </li></ul><ul><li>Se trata de una abstracción que se concentra en aspectos esenciales e inherentes de una organización e ignora las propiedades accesorias. </li></ul>
  2. 4. <ul><li>Es una colección integrada de conceptos, para describir y manipular datos, las relaciones existentes entre los mismos y las restricciones aplicables a los datos, todo ello dentro de una organización </li></ul>
  3. 5. <ul><li>Parte Estructural: Compuesta por un conjunto de reglas que son las que definen cómo pueden construirse las bases de datos. </li></ul><ul><li>Parte Manipulativa: Define los tipos de operaciones que pueden realizarse sobe los datos . </li></ul><ul><li>Conjunto de Restricciones de Integridad: Garantiza la precisión de los datos </li></ul>
  4. 6. <ul><li>Es de representar los datos y hacer que sean comprensibles . </li></ul><ul><li>Si se consigue </li></ul><ul><li>Se podrá utilizar con facilidad para diseñar una base de datos, </li></ul>
  5. 7. <ul><li>Modelo de Datos Externos: Representan la vista que cada usuario tiene de la organización . Se denomina en ocasiones Universo de Discurso . </li></ul><ul><li>Modelo de Datos Conceptual: Representan la vista lógica (o comunitaria), que es independiente del SGBD. </li></ul><ul><li>Modelo de Datos Interno: Representa el esquema conceptual de tal forma que puede ser comprendido por el SGBD. </li></ul>
  6. 8. <ul><li>Basados en Objetos. </li></ul><ul><li>Basados en Registros. </li></ul><ul><li>Físicos. </li></ul><ul><li>Los primeros dos se utilizan para describir los datos a nivel conceptual y externo, mientras que el último se emplea para describir los datos a nivel interno </li></ul>
  7. 9. Modelos de Datos basados en Objetos <ul><li>Utilizan conceptos tales como entidades, atributos y relaciones. </li></ul><ul><li>Tipos de modelos da datos basado en objetos </li></ul><ul><ul><ul><li>Entidad-Relación. </li></ul></ul></ul><ul><ul><ul><li>Semántico. </li></ul></ul></ul><ul><ul><ul><li>Funcional. </li></ul></ul></ul><ul><ul><ul><li>Orientado a Objetos. </li></ul></ul></ul><ul><li>Este modelo amplia la definición de entidad para incluir no sólo los atributos que describen el estado del objeto, sino también las asociadas con el objeto, su comportamiento. </li></ul><ul><li>En este caso, decimos que el objeto encapsula tanto el estado como el comportamiento. </li></ul>
  8. 10. <ul><li>Su base de datos está compuesta por una serie de registros de formato fijo, posiblemente de tipos distintos. </li></ul><ul><li>Cada tipo de registro define un número fijo de campos, el mismo que sabe tener una longitud fija. </li></ul><ul><li>Tipos de datos basados en registros. </li></ul><ul><li>Modelo de Datos Relacional.. </li></ul><ul><li>Modelo de Datos en red. </li></ul><ul><li>Modelo de Datos Jerárquico. </li></ul><ul><li>Los modelos de datos en red y jerárquico fueron desarrollados casi 10 años antes que el modelo de datos relacional, por lo que se relacionan con los conceptos tradicionales de procesamiento de archivos resultantes más evidentes </li></ul>
  9. 11. <ul><li>Esta basado en el concepto de relaciones matemáticas. </li></ul><ul><li>Los datos y las relaciones se representan mediante tablas, cada una tiene una serie de columnas con nombres distintivos. </li></ul><ul><li>Se enlazan mediante un atributo específico. </li></ul><ul><li>El modelo de base de datos relacional sólo requiere que la base de datos sea percibida por el usuario como una serie de tablas. </li></ul><ul><li>Está percepción solo se aplica a los niveles externo y conceptual de la arquitectura ANSU-SPARC, no se aplica a la estructura física de la base </li></ul>
  10. 12. <ul><li>Los datos se representan se representan como una colección de registros , mientras que las relaciones se representan mediantes conjuntos. </li></ul><ul><li>Las relaciones están modeladas de forma explícita por los conjuntos, que se transforman en punteros a la hora de la implementación. </li></ul><ul><li>Los registros se organizan como estructuras de grafos generalizados , en la que los registros aparecen como nodos y los conjuntos como aristas del grafo. </li></ul>
  11. 13. <ul><li>Es un tipo registrado de modelo en red. </li></ul><ul><li>Los datos se representan como colecciones de registros , la relaciones mediante conjuntos. Solo permite que cada nodo solo tenga un o padrea. </li></ul><ul><li>Este modelo se puede representar como un grafo en árbol, donde los registros a parecen como nodos los conjuntos como aristas. </li></ul>
  12. 14. Modelo de datos Físico <ul><li>Describe como se almacenan los datos en la computadora, representando información tal como las estructuras de registro, el ordenamiento de los registros y las rutas de acceso. No hay tantos modelos físicos de datos como modelos lógicos, y los modelos físicos más comunes son el modelo unificador y la memoria de marco </li></ul>
  13. 15. Modelado Conceptual <ul><li>El esquema conceptual es el “corazón” de la base de datos. Da soporte a todas las vistas externas y se apoya, a su vez, en el esquema interno. </li></ul><ul><li>Es la implementación física del esquema conceptual. </li></ul><ul><li>El esquema conceptual debe ser una representación completa y precisa de los requisitos de datos de organización </li></ul>
  14. 16. <ul><li>El modelo conceptual, o diseño conceptual de la base de datos: </li></ul><ul><li>Es el proceso de construir un modelo del uso de la información dentro de una empresa. </li></ul><ul><li>El modelo debe ser independiente de los detalles de implementación, como por ejemplo SGBD de destino, los programas de aplicación, los lenguajes de programación o cualquier otro tipo de consideración física. </li></ul>
  15. 17. <ul><li>Los modelos conceptuales también se suelen denominar modelos lógicos y conceptuales. </li></ul><ul><li>El modelo conceptual es independiente de todos los detalles de implementación, mientras que el modelo lógico presupone un conocimiento del modelo de datos subyacentes en el SGBD de destino. </li></ul>
  16. 18. Integrantes <ul><li>Gabriel Requelme </li></ul><ul><li>Anabel Ruíz </li></ul><ul><li>David Torres </li></ul>

×